Junior Project Coordinator (Entry-Level)
Wayne, NJ
Salary: $45,000 - $60,000 (based on experience)
Company Overview:
We are a fast-growing construction trade company located in Wayne, NJ. We are seeking an energetic, detail-oriented candidate to join our team as a Junior Project Coordinator. This is an exciting opportunity for someone looking to grow their career in project coordination within the construction industry.
Position Overview:
As a Junior Project Coordinator, you will assist in managing project timelines, coordinating with vendors and clients, and ensuring projects run smoothly from start to finish. This role is ideal for a motivated individual who is organized, tech-savvy, and ready to take on responsibility.
The Ideal Candidate:
• Computer literate and comfortable using Excel and project management software
• Highly organized with strong multitasking skills
• Excellent verbal and written communication skills
• Eager to learn and grow within the construction trade industry
Key Responsibilities:
• Assist in coordinating daily project activities and schedules
• Communicate with clients, vendors, and internal teams
• Maintain project documentation and track project progress
• Help ensure projects are completed on time and within budget
• Support senior project managers with administrative tasks
Qualifications:
•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el and general computer skills
• Excellent communication and organizational skills
• Ability to manage multiple priorities under pressure
• No prior construction management experience required — we will train!
Must-Haves:
• Computer literacy (Excel is a must)
• Strong multitasking abilities
• Clear and professional communication
• Positive attitude and willingness to learn
Benefits:
• Growth opportunities within a fast-paced company
• Hands-on training and mentorship
• Professional development support
